Transaction 221e03086008d1df71f331982bb66e6832cc49863c416ccf6dfd27ebd2ec707b

5 Input
2 Outputs
  • 221e03086008d1df71f331982bb66e6832cc49863c416ccf6dfd27ebd2ec707b:0
  • value  1620000
    address  3FxG8FLvGYby5Z9E79M9TKBvdW54c1cPR4
  • 221e03086008d1df71f331982bb66e6832cc49863c416ccf6dfd27ebd2ec707b:1
  • value  894569
    address  3DWpHv8Whs3Ckq1dECwnJs3CWbwGox9Np7